Description
The Council is responsible to maintain those City Council highways which are 'adopted' and that are maintainable at the public expense.
This framework is the supply in respect of Permanent & Temporary Signs across Nottingham City Council's boundaries.
The works required will cover a number of activities; and may require the Contractor to co-operate and co-ordinate with Council employees, other Contractors or consultants, or other parties identified by the Employer in the context of a given project.
The framework agreement is to supply up to a total value of £840,000 (including VAT)
The framework length is expected to be a period of up to 4 Years.

Framework operation description
Call-offs from the framework will be made by Direct Award.
Each project will be priced solely using the rates set out in the Pricing Schedule and will be awarded as Direct Awards by Basket of Rates
